The Samsung Note 2 I317 is a 5.5-inch unlocked GSM smartphone featuring a vibrant Super AMOLED display, a 1.6 GHz quad-core Exynos processor, and 16GB internal storage expandable up to 64GB. It supports 4G LTE connectivity on major GSM carriers, includes an 8MP rear camera with LED flash, and offers stylus-driven software for enhanced note-taking and creativity. Glad I took a chance =)
I was a bit wary, based on some reviews. Now, I am happy to say, it was a good decision. Before I spout about how much I love this phone, a few things need to be mentioned: 1) This phone came NEW (the seller I bought it from is no longer selling it, though) 2) This phone needs to be unlocked with a CODE that is PROVIDED by the seller and is on a sticker on the side of the phone box. It is a very easy process... I took a pic but scribbled out the code in Paper Artist before uploading, so it is a bit artsy (didn't feel like downloading a photo editing app - for some reason, it didn't come with one). 3) If you are using Straight Talk, you won't need to unlock it. 4) I am writing this review in my own handwriting and it is converting it to text!! Pic added for emphasis. NOTE: You can take a screenshot and write on it (hold down the button on the stylus and touch pen to screen for a couple seconds), but you have to download an app to scribble on photos, I guess. 5) Downloading the manual and taking time to read through all the features is HIGHLY recommended. There are tons that most people never use. 6) Most people will not need all the features this phone has to offer. It is a phone that works. And by work I mean multi-task and simplify all your tasks for business and/or school. That being said, I am a student of Graphic and Web Design and I have a few projects for businesses I am working on. I have been wanting a tablet that I can draw, sketch ideas, and take notes with, but haven't found one reasonably priced (I have a pretty small budget) that could accomplish what I needed. In other news, I wanted a new phone badly. My iPhone 4 was worthless for what I wanted/needed for school and work. I killed two birds with one stone by getting this phone! I have nothing but praise for the S Pen. Amazingly accurate and looks like my own handwriting, which is something I have only seen in a Microsoft Surface Pro. Must be that Wacom technology. The stylus is superior even to my Wacom Bamboo stylus! I have already sketched out some ideas for a new website and the possibilities for school and work efficiency are endless with this thing. My calendars were synced, emails, google drive, etc. Makes it easier than checking all that stuff from my laptop. I won't bother with specs, those have been covered in other reviews. Battery life: the more you have going on, the more battery you use. Sorry. Overall, a money-saving purchase for someone who wants a small tablet and a phone but can only afford one and doesn't want to carry both around. Win-Win! ***EDIT: 10/25/2018*** Two phones later, this phone is still working great for me. I have upgraded to the Note 4, lost it, bought a Note 5, had to return it, and am using this while this whole process gets sorted. Just popped my SIM back in and it works fine. The Operating system is really old and no longer receives updates from AT&T, but that is fixable with some Google-Fu and rooting chops. Still very happy with this phone.

faulty phones, generic battery and terrible customer service
I hate this phone with a passion. I don't think the problem is from the phone but from the sellers. I used this type of phone in the past and I loved it. I broke the screen and decided to get the same type but it was a total disappointment. I ordered the phone from these sellers and it came faulty: it didn't come on for more than a day, and when it did, the it couldn't work with any headphones. I returned the phone and wanted a replacement, it took almost a month to get the a new phone back. They really have bad customer service, it is terrible. The new phone is super terrible; the wifi use to work about 3days in the week, and that will even connect by restarting the phone. I was thinking it was temporal and I didn't want to go through the hustle with these sellers, so I didn't return it. Unfortunately, the wifi is permanently off now. It doesn't detect any wifi anywhere I go. The battery that came with the second phone was generic, it couldn't even go 4hrs. I had to use the battery from my old broken screen-phone. I wouldn't advice anyone to get this phone, most especially from this particular sellers.
